Freelancer vs. Web Design Agency
When it comes to building or redesigning your website, most businesses face a familiar decision:
- Hire a freelancer for speed, savings, and flexibility
- Or go with a web design agency for full-service power and long-term support
It's a valid comparison. But what if that either/or thinking is too limiting?
There's a third, smarter option—a hybrid model that gives you the best of both worlds.
Let's explore the traditional paths first—and then explain why this hybrid approach might be the smart choice your business hasn't considered yet.
Option 1: The Freelancer
Best for: Simple projects, short time lines. If you're on a tight budget and need a simple brochure-style website, hiring a freelancer might suffice.
Freelancers often specialize in one or two key areas. Many are talented designers or developers, capable of spinning up brochure-style sites or customizing templates. They're flexible, direct, and may cost less up front.
Challenges with freelancers:
- Limited capacity — complex needs may outgrow their skillset
- Less reliability — timelines can slip if they're juggling clients
- Less support — ongoing updates and strategy may fall outside their scope
Option 2: The Web Design Agency
Best for: Large-scale builds, organizations with internal marketing teams, or long-term digital strategy.
Agencies bring full teams to the table—designers, developers, SEO experts, and project managers. They follow processes and offer robust support plans. Whether you need additional features, more robust hosting. They take the time to understand your brand, target audience, and business goals. This holistic approach results in a website that's not only visually appealing but also strategically aligned with your objectives.
Challenges with agencies:
- Higher cost structures and overhead
- Less direct contact — communication often goes through multiple layers
- Rigid packages — customization or quick pivots may take longer
A Third Option: The Hybrid Model
Best for: Businesses that want expert-level results and a personalized, agile partnership.
Hybrid models offer a unique middle-ground solution. A blend of specialized expertise and reliability of a web design agency with the direct attention and adaptability of a freelancer.
You get:
- Strategic insight from someone who understands your goals
- Hands-on execution without layers of middle management
- Access to external specialists (developers, SEO pros, writers) brought in as needed—just like a web design agency, but more flexible
It’s like having your cake and eating it too—a custom-built team without the agency markup or freelancer limitations.
Conclusion
There’s no one-size-fits-all answer. Freelancers and agencies both serve a purpose. But if you're a business that’s growing—or one that values partnership, strategy, and results—you don’t need to compromise between the two.
The hybrid model gives you:
- The brainpower of a team
- The relationship of a trusted advisor
- The ability to scale—without starting over
